[PATCH] staging: bcm2835-camera: Replace open-coded idr with a struct idr.

> Eric Anholt <eric at anholt.net> hat am 11. Mai 2018 um 01:31 geschrieben:
> 
> 
> We just need some integer handles that can map back to our message
> struct when we're handling a reply, which struct idr is perfect for.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Eric Anholt <eric at anholt.net>
> ---
>  .../vc04_services/bcm2835-camera/mmal-vchiq.c | 135 ++++--------------
>  1 file changed, 31 insertions(+), 104 deletions(-)

>  static struct mmal_msg_context *
>  get_msg_context(struct vchiq_mmal_instance *instance)
>  {
>  	struct mmal_msg_context *msg_context;
> +	int handle;
>  
>  	/* todo: should this be allocated from a pool to avoid kzalloc */
>  	msg_context = kzalloc(sizeof(*msg_context), GFP_KERNEL);
> @@ -258,32 +181,40 @@ get_msg_context(struct vchiq_mmal_instance *instance)
>  	if (!msg_context)
>  		return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
>  
> -	msg_context->instance = instance;
> -	msg_context->handle =
> -		mmal_context_map_create_handle(&instance->context_map,
> -					       msg_context,
> -					       GFP_KERNEL);
> +	/* Create an ID that will be passed along with our message so
> +	 * that when we service the VCHI reply, we can look up what
> +	 * message is being replied to.
> +	 */
> +	spin_lock(&instance->context_map_lock);
> +	handle = idr_alloc(&instance->context_map, msg_context,
> +			   0, 0, GFP_KERNEL);
> +	spin_unlock(&instance->context_map_lock);
>  
> -	if (!msg_context->handle) {
> +	if (msg_context->handle < 0) {

handle < 0 ?

>  		kfree(msg_context);
> -		return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
> +		return ERR_PTR(handle);
>  	}
>  
> +	msg_context->instance = instance;
> +	msg_context->handle = handle;
> +
>  	return msg_context;
>  }
>
